
通过虚拟化,企业能够更高效地管理硬件资源,降低运营成本,并提升系统的灵活性和可扩展性
而在众多虚拟化技术中,微软的Hyper-V无疑是一款备受推崇的解决方案
那么,Hyper-V究竟在哪里?它如何工作?本文将深入探讨这一问题,带您全面了解这款功能强大的虚拟化技术产品
Hyper-V的概述 Hyper-V是微软开发的硬件虚拟化产品,用于创建和运行虚拟机
虚拟机是计算机的软件版本,能够独立运行各自的操作系统和应用程序,就像真实的物理机一样
通过Hyper-V,用户可以在一台主机上创建和运行多个虚拟机,实现硬件资源的高效利用
Hyper-V最初是在Windows Server 2008中引入的,作为微软服务器虚拟化战略的一部分
它不仅可以在Windows Server上作为服务器角色安装,还可以作为64位Windows客户端操作系统的一项功能,或者作为独立的“Microsoft Hyper-V Server”产品使用
每个版本的Hyper-V都包含类似的功能,但针对特定的应用场景,用户可以选择最适合的版本
Hyper-V的工作原理 Hyper-V的工作原理基于高效的硬件利用和隔离技术
它通过虚拟机监控程序(Hypervisor)这一软件层来控制对主机物理硬件的访问
虚拟机监控程序位于硬件和虚拟机之间,完全控制着硬件虚拟化功能,并确保这些功能不会向来宾操作系统(Guest OS)公开
在Hyper-V环境中,主机操作系统(也称为父分区)运行在虚拟机监控程序之上,而所有的虚拟机(来宾操作系统)只能与虚拟化硬件通信
这种架构使得Hyper-V能够提供更高的安全性和隔离性,通过内置的安全功能如安全启动和保护措施来保护虚拟机和主机免受恶意软件和攻击
Hyper-V的核心功能 Hyper-V提供了丰富的功能,使其适用于多种应用场景
以下是一些关键的功能特性: 1.广泛的操作系统支持:Hyper-V支持同时运行不同类型的操作系统,包括32位和64位的多种服务器和桌面操作系统
这使得用户可以在虚拟机中享受到多线程应用程序的优势
2.硬件共享架构:通过使用新的虚拟服务供应程序/虚拟服务客户端(VSP/VSC)架构,Hyper-V增强了核心资源的访问和使用,如磁盘、网络以及视频
3.高效的资源利用:Hyper-V通过高效的硬件利用技术,使得在同一物理硬件上可以同时运行多个虚拟机,从而提高了硬件资源的利用率,降低了成本
4.管理和连接:Hyper-V提供了多种管理和连接工具,如Hyper-V管理器、用于Windows PowerShell的Hyper-V模块、虚拟机连接(VMConnect)和Windows PowerShell Direct,方便用户管理Hyper-V环境
5.可移植性:为了更轻松地移动或分发虚拟机,Hyper-V提供了诸如实时迁移、存储迁移以及标准导入/导出功能之类的功能
6.灾难恢复和备份:Hyper-V支持Hyper-V副本,这会在其他物理位置创建虚拟机副本
用户可以根据需要使用这些副本来还原虚拟机实例
此外,还支持生产检查点和对卷影复制服务(VSS)的备份
7.安全性:Hyper-V支持安全性功能,如安全启动和受防护的虚拟机
安全启动在启动过程中验证文件上的数字签名以防范恶意软件
受防护的虚拟机中的虚拟磁盘会进行加密,以确保安全访问,并且虚拟机只能在特定的受保护主机上运行
Hyper-V的应用场景 Hyper-V的广泛应用场景使其成为企业IT管理中的重要工具
以下是一些主要的应用场景: 1.服务器虚拟化:使用Hyper-V,企业可以将多个物理服务器合并为更少、功能更强大的计算机,从而减少使用的空间和消耗的能耗
2.桌面虚拟化:通过将Hyper-V和Windows Server的远程桌面虚拟化结合使用,企业可以实现使用虚拟桌面基础结构(VDI)的集中式桌面管理解决方案,为用户提供安全、敏捷且个性化的虚拟机或虚拟机池
3.云计算:Hyper-V提供灵活的按需服务,其功能与公有云服务非常类似
通过Azure Stack超融合基础设施(HCI),企业可以在本地运行虚拟化工作负载,实现私有云基础结构
4.开发和测试环境:通过使用虚拟化技术,企业可以复制开发或测试环境,而无需购买或维护物理硬件或隔离网络系统
Hyper-V可以快速配置虚拟化开发和测试环境,并根据需要还原它们,同时不影响生产系统
Hyper-V的安装和配置 安装和配置Hyper-V相对简单,可以通过多种工具完成
以下是安装Hyper-V的基本步骤: 1.打开控制面板:在Windows操作系统中,打开控制面板,选择“程序和功能”
2.启用Hyper-V:在“启用或关闭Windows功能”中,勾选“Hyper-V”和“虚拟机平台”,然后点击“安装”并重启计算机
3.使用Hyper-V管理器:在开始菜单中搜索“Hyper-V管理器”并打开它
通过Hyper-V管理器,用户可以创建和管理虚拟机
4.新建虚拟机:在Hyper-V管理器中,选择“新建-虚拟机”,然后根据向导配置虚拟机的名称、存储路径、代数、内存、网络、虚拟硬盘和操作系统
5.启动虚拟机:配置完成后,用户可以启动虚拟机并安装操作系统
Hyper-V的硬件要求 虽然Hyper-V功能强大,但它对硬件也有一定的要求
以下是Hyper-V的基本硬件要求: 1.处理器:必须具有二级地址转换(SLAT)的64位处理器,并支持虚拟机监视器模式扩展
2.内存:至少需要2GB的内存,但建议根据要运行的虚拟机数量分配更多的内存
3.存储:确保主机对于虚拟机使用的虚拟硬盘(VHD)有足够的存储空间,并且存储子系统具有高吞吐量,以支持多个同时访问存储的虚拟机
4.网络:Hyper-V主机必须为每个虚拟机分配足够的网络容量,有时需要在主机中分配不同的专用网络适配器
5.虚拟化技术:主机硬件需要支持硬件辅助虚拟化技术,如Intel VT或AMD-V,并启用硬件强制的数据执行保护(DEP)
Hyper-V的维护和问题解决 在使用Hyper-V的过程中,可能会遇到一些问题
以下是一些常见的错误和解决方法: 1.存储空间不足:由于动态磁盘和维护任务定期消耗Hyper-V主机上的空间,用户应该始终监视存储Hyper-V虚拟机文件的磁盘空间,并及时删除不必要的检查点
2.ISO映像配置错误:如果ISO映像文件路径不正确或文件被移动或删除,可能会导致虚拟机无法启动
用户应该检查并更正ISO文件路径
3.网络适配器配置错误:在执行Hyper-V实时迁移时,如果虚拟机迁移到不存在虚拟交换机的Hyper-V主机,可能会导致无法更改状态错误
用户应该检查虚拟机的网络适配器配置
4.Hyper-V虚拟管理服务未运行:如果Hyper-V虚拟管理服务(VMMS)未正确运行,可能会导致虚拟机无法正常工作
用户可以通过服务管理器检查并重新启动该服务
5.防病毒软件阻止访问:有时防病毒软件可能会阻止对Hyper-V虚拟机文件的访问
用户可以将虚拟机文件夹添加到防病毒设置中的排除项中
结论 综上所述,Hyper-V是微软开发的一款功能强大的虚拟化技术产品,它提供了丰富的功能和高度的灵活性,适用于多种应用场景
通过合理的安装和配置以及有效的问题解决与维护技巧,可以充分发挥Hyper-V的优势,实现硬件资源的高效利用和成本的降低
在现代企业的IT管理中,Hyper-V无疑是一款不可或缺的利器
它不仅能够帮助企业实现服务器虚拟化、桌面虚拟化和云计算等应用场景,还能够提高系统的安全性和隔离性,降低运营成本
因此,对于那些正在寻找高效、可靠且可扩展的虚拟化解决方案的企业来说,Hyper-V无疑是一个明智的选择
抖音搜索热潮:揭秘VMware虚拟化技术的无限可能
寻找Hyper-V:位置全解析
Linux权限0755详解:安全与访问控制
Hyper-V设置全攻略:轻松搭建虚拟环境
VMware虚拟器下载指南:快速安装,轻松体验虚拟化技术
VMware免费方案:高效虚拟化入门指南
Xshell外观设置:打造个性化终端界面
Hyper-V设置全攻略:轻松搭建虚拟环境
Hyper-V虚拟机配置静态IP教程
寻找Hyper-V:虚拟机位置揭秘
Hyper-V虚拟机设置静态IP教程
寻找电脑Hyper-V功能位置指南
Hyper-V设置静态MAC地址教程
Hyper-V安装位置:探寻存放文件夹
解决Hyper-V设置卡顿,快速指南
如何设置Hyper-V开机自启动
Hyper-V设置:轻松实现开机自启教程
如何在电脑中关闭Hyper-V功能
Hyper-V快照设置全攻略